Every day, hazardous materials are shipped in this country—materials that could threaten the safety of individuals, property, and the environment. These materials are transported by truck, by train, by air, and by water. Because of the risks posed by transporting hazardous materials, you need to know about the potential dangers and steps you must take to help protect yourself and others against them. In this interactive, online course, we’ll cover some general requirements associated with transporting hazardous materials. We’ll look at what’s meant by the term hazardous materials, and we’ll see how these materials are classified. We’ll also look at documentation and packaging that must be used when hazardous materials are shipped, and we’ll look at labels and placards used to identify hazardous materials.
